Tripura Medical Counselling Committee has opened NEET UG 2026 Round 1 registration on trmcc.admissions.nic.in. Candidates qualifying NEET UG 2026 can apply for MBBS BDS BHMS BAMS and BASLP seats from August 18 2026.
The Tripura Medical Counselling Committee (TRMCC) has opened Round 1 registration. NEET UG 2026 qualified candidates can now apply on the official portal. Registration began on August 18, 2026 at trmcc.admissions.nic.in.
The counselling covers admissions to MBBS, BDS, BHMS, BAMS and BASLP courses. The Directorate of Medical Education, Government of Tripura, oversees this process. Round 1 will fill both government and private college seats.
Tripura NEET UG 2026 Counselling Registration Fees
The registration fee is non-refundable and varies by category. The table below lists the fees for Round 1 applicants.
| Category | Registration Fee |
| General / OBC-NCL (State Domicile) | Rs 2,500 |
| General-EWS / OBC-NCL (Non-Domicile) | Rs 2,000 |
| SC / ST / PwD / Other | Rs 1,800 |
Tripura NEET UG 2026 Security Deposit
A mandatory security deposit is payable along with the registration fee. The amount depends on the seat type and candidate category.
| Seat Type | Category | Security Deposit |
| Government | SC / ST | Rs 5,000 |
| Government | Others | Rs 10,000 |
| Non-Government | All categories | Rs 1,00,000 |
Who Is Eligible to Apply?
Candidates must have qualified NEET UG 2026 to apply. They must also hold a valid Tripura Permanent Resident Certificate. Non-domicile candidates may apply under specific reserved quotas only.
Documents Required for Registration
Keep the following documents scanned and ready before starting the application.
- NEET UG 2026 admit card and scorecard
- Class 10 certificate as age proof
- Class 12 mark sheet and pass certificate
- Tripura Permanent Resident Certificate (PRC)
- Category certificate for SC, ST or OBC-NCL applicants
- EWS certificate valid from April 2025 to March 2026
- WESM certificate wherever applicable
- Disability certificate for PwD candidates
- Recent passport-size photograph and scanned signature
How to Register for Tripura NEET UG 2026 Counselling?
Follow the steps below to complete your Round 1 registration.
- Visit the official portal at trmcc.admissions.nic.in.
- Click on the Round 1 registration link on the homepage.
- Enter your NEET UG 2026 roll number and personal details.
- Fill in academic, category and contact information carefully.
- Upload scanned documents in the prescribed format and size.
- Pay the registration fee and security deposit online.
- Submit the form and download the confirmation slip.
Counselling Stages After Registration
The counselling flow follows a fixed sequence after registration closes.
- Document verification by the Directorate of Medical Education
- Publication of the state merit list on the portal
- Online choice filling and locking by verified candidates
- Round 1 seat allotment and nomination letter release
- Reporting at the allotted college with original documents
Why Round 1 Matters
Round 1 usually opens the widest pool of seats. Higher-ranked candidates secure the best colleges at this stage. Missing this window pushes candidates into later, thinner rounds.

Q: What is the official website for Tripura NEET UG 2026 registration?
The official website for Tripura NEET UG 2026 Round 1 Counselling registration is trmcc.admissions.nic.in.
Q: Who is eligible for the 85% state quota seats in Tripura?
Candidates who have qualified for NEET UG 2026 and meet the domicile requirements set by the Directorate of Medical Education (DME) Tripura, usually involving long-term residency or parent's government employment in the state.
Q: What happens if I miss the Round 1 registration deadline?
If you miss the Round 1 deadline, you may have to wait for the Round 2 or Mop-up round registration, provided the DME allows fresh registrations. However, you will lose the opportunity to claim seats that are filled in the first round.
Q: Can I change my choices after locking them?
No, once choices are locked on the trmcc portal, they cannot be changed for that specific round. You may have the option to modify them in subsequent rounds of counselling.
